Output 6c12edb966fd3403d70aa532330adf388e20605986bd70d5baee4d602878bece:1

value
5177800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 276a503a4dd5e8c268553ab91f5de3c14d9983d1 OP_EQUAL
address
35HRdosZuLvpNmksMv2XsJzsqGqKPVRRng
transaction
6c12edb966fd3403d70aa532330adf388e20605986bd70d5baee4d602878bece
confirmations
338943
spent
true